The Language of Film.
Whitaker, Rod
This book, designed for the film maker, critic, and serious filmgoer, explores elements of filmic expression from the creative and perceptual points of view. Chapters (1) trace the linguistic and mechanical development of film, (2) discuss the contributions of image and sound to film content, (3) suggest the contributions of editing and montage, (4) examine plot, theme, narrative organization, and histrionics, (5) deal with the role of meaning in the modern film, and (6) take an overview of the nonlinguistic modes of the avant-garde and the underground. Photographs illustrating framing techniques are included, as are an index of topics and an index of names. (DD)
